The monthly number of permits granted for building houses in a large city is seasonal (there tend to be more permits granted for construction during spring and summer months than during winter months). The following table shows the monthly seasonal indexes for building permits:
JAN FEB MAR APR MAY JUN JUL AUG SEP OCT NOV DEC
0.75 0.84 0.98 1.07 1.30 1.31 1.15 1.07 0.95 0.95 0.84 0.79
Using several years of permit data, beginning in August of 2001(i.e., t= 1 corresponds to August of 2001), an analyst reported that the trend line that describes the monthly permit data is of the form . Assuming Tt = 761 + 5t that a multiplicative model can be used to describe the building permit data, generate a forecast for the number of building permits that you expect will be granted in June of 2006.
